POINT ARENA, CA Something fresh is coming to Point Arena. Saturday, July 4th, designer Charlie Fisher is opening Altered State — a new clothing boutique and creative community space.

Charlie, known for her popular August Valentine brand and boutique bus, has built a loyal following by turning reclaimed materials into stylish, zero-waste clothing. At Altered State, she’ll offer her signature handmade pieces alongside carefully selected vintage clothing, jewelry, furniture, music, and art from other local designers. Hail Creek will be showcasing for the first time. Brilliant, fresh, masculine streetwear.

The “altered” experience goes beyond shopping: the shop will offer on-demand clothing alterations, sewing workshops, skill-sharing sessions, and regular clothing swaps. It’s designed as a welcoming place to create, connect, and learn — with Charlie’s goal being “a space where looking at your phone feels criminal.”
